Scepter/Mace constructed of iron in the form of a demon head with horns. The face etching simulating eyebrows, mustache, ears and eyeballs protrude from surface. Other etched decoration include floral pattern and the back of the head portrays two human figures. Persia,18th Century
Reference: 'Islamic Weapons' by Anthony C. Tirri, p. 219, Fig. 157 & 'A Glossary of the Construction, Decoration and Use of Arms and Armor: in All Countries and in All Times' by George Cameron Stone', p. 422, Fig. 533, Illus. 6. Size: L. 29.5" x W. 4.5" Weight: 1lbs 2oz Condition: Very good, the head a bit loose on the shaft, wear to etching especially on the shaft.
